The 2nd (City of London) Battalion, The London Regiment (Royal Fusiliers) was a volunteer infantry unit that existed from 1908 to 1961, serving in World War I with notable actions in Gallipoli and on the Western Front and in World War II in Iraq, North Africa, and Italy. After serving as an air defence unit post-WWII, it reverted to infantry and merged into the Royal Fusiliers' Territorial Battalion.
